What is a Job Profit Calculator?

A job profit calculator is a specialized financial tool that helps businesses determine the profitability of specific jobs or projects. It takes into account various cost factors such as materials, labor, overhead, and other expenses, and compares them against the revenue generated by the job. The result is a clear picture of the net profit or loss for each job, providing valuable insights into your business performance.

How to Use a Job Profit Calculator

  1. Gather Cost Data:
  • Collect detailed information about all costs associated with the job. This includes direct costs like materials and labor, as well as indirect costs such as overhead and administrative expenses.
  1. Input Revenue:
  • Enter the total revenue generated from the job. This should include all sources of income related to the project.
  1. Calculate Profit:
  • Use the calculator to subtract the total costs from the total revenue. The result is your net profit or loss for the job.
  1. Analyze Results:
  • Review the results to identify trends and insights. Look for patterns in profitability and consider how you can replicate success in future projects.
  1. Adjust Strategies:
  • Use the insights gained from the calculator to adjust your business strategies. This might involve renegotiating supplier contracts, adjusting pricing, or optimizing resource allocation.
